By now, Megan Thee Stallion has solidified her status as an international superstar. 2022 saw the Houston native headlining shows all across the globe, and while she began 2023 on a quiet note, recent months have seen her back on the stage in full force. Her most recent performance took place on Friday (June 9) in Los Angeles, where Megan happily showed out in support of the LGBTQ+ community at Pride in the Park.
Besides performing fan favourites like “Body,” “Big Ole Freak,” and “Simon Says” for the crowd, the fashionista also brought up some attendees to show off their dance moves. As we’ve seen in the past, it was a male member of Thee Hotties who primarily caught Megan’s attention thanks to his wildly impressive twerking skills on her stage. TikTok star Markell Washington is currently going viral thanks to his grooving alongside the “Plan B” hitmaker which left her too stunned to speak.

A ninth Gorillaz album is on the horizon. On Thursday, the Damon Albarn-created group announced that it will drop a 15-track collaborative album, titled The Mountain, on March 20, 2026, featuring stars from across the globe. To celebrate the news, the band released “The Happy Dictator” featuring Sparks.
Each of the songs features at least one collaborator, and will feature artists singing in Arabic, Hindi, Spanish, and Yoruba. Idles is featured on “The God of Lying.” Argentinian DJ Bizarrap joins Kara Jackson and Anoushka Shankar on “Orange County,” and Argentine rapper Trueno will appear with Proof on “The Manifesto.”
A press release for the record described The Mountain as a “playlist for a party on the border between this world and whatever happens next, exploring the journey of life and the thrill of existence.” The album was recorded at Studio 13 in London, along with cities in India, Miami, Ashgabat, Damascus, and New York. The album is the first under their indie record label, Kong.
Along with the album, the band will tour the United Kingdom and Ireland in March, with stops in Manchester, Glasgow, Leeds, Liverpool, Belfast, and Dublin. Then, the band will perform in June at London’s Tottenham Hotspur Stadium. Trueno will join the band as an opener for most dates.
The Mountain is the first studio album since 2023’s Cracker Island, which featured collaborations with artists such as Stevie Nicks, Tame Impala, Bad Bunny, and Beck.
The Mountain Track List
1. “The Mountain” feat. Dennis Hopper, Ajay Prasanna, Anoushka Shankar, Amaan Ali Bangash, and Ayaan Ali Bangash
2. “The Moon Cave” feat. Asha Puthli, Bobby Womack, Dave Jolicoeur, Jalen Ngonda, and Black Thought
3. “The Happy Dictator” feat. Sparks
4. “The Hardest Thing” feat. Tony Allen
5. “Orange County” feat. Bizarrap, Kara Jackson, and Anoushka Shankar
6. “The God of Lying” feat. IDLES
7. “The Empty Dream Machine” feat. Black Thought, Johnny Marr, and Anoushka Shankar
8. “The Manifesto” feat. Trueno and Proof
9. “The Plastic Guru” feat. Johnny Marr and Anoushka Shankar
10. “Delirium” feat. Mark E. Smith
11. “Damascus” feat. Omar Souleyman and Yasiin Bey
12. “The Shadowy Light” feat. Asha Bhosle, Gruff Rhys, Ajay Prasanna, Amaan Ali Bangash, and Ayaan Ali Bangash
13. “Casablanca” feat. Paul Simonon and Johnny Marr
14. “The Sweet Prince” feat. Ajay Prasanna, Johnny Marr, and Anoushka Shankar
15. “The Sad God” feat. Black Thought, Ajay Prasann,a and Anoushka Shankaro
